27 How To Use Callback In Javascript
JavaScript functions are objects. This statement is the key to understanding many of the more advanced JavaScript topics, including callback functions. Functions, like any other object, can be assigned to variables, be passed as arguments to other functions, and created within and returned ... 17/7/2018 · If we want to execute a function right after the return of some other function, then callbacks can be used. JavaScript functions have the type of Objects. So, much like any other objects (String, Arrays etc.), They can be passed as an argument to any other function while calling. JavaScript code to show the working of callback: Code #1:
The callback function runs after the completion of the outer function. It is useful to develop an asynchronous JavaScript code. In JavaScript, a callback is easier to create. That is, we simply have to pass the callback function as a parameter to another function and call it right after the completion of the task.
How to use callback in javascript. More complexly put: In JavaScript, functions are objects. Because of this, functions can take functions as arguments, and can be returned by other functions. Functions that do this are called higher-order functions. Any function that is passed as an argument is called a callback function. May 31, 2019 - To further illustrate how callback ‘this’ will point to the invoking object or function, now we are going to call our callback as a method defined on an object. This is an unlikely scenario in actual JavaScript programming, but a useful example nonetheless that ‘this’ binding works ... Dec 23, 2020 - The callback function is one of those concepts that every JavaScript developer should know. Callbacks are used in arrays, timer functions, promises, event handlers, and much more.
Dec 02, 2014 - Because functions are first-class ... it to be executed later. This is the essence of using callback functions in JavaScript. In the rest of this article we will learn everything about JavaScript callback functions. Callback functions are probably the most widely used functional ... This is why understanding JavaScript callbacks is essential to understanding asynchronous programming in JavaScript. In the client browser callbacks enable JavaScript code to make a call that might take a long time to respond, like a web service API call, without "freezing" the web page while it waits for a response. Here, we told JavaScript to listen for the click event on a button. If a click is detected, JavaScript should fire the clicked function. So, in this case, clicked is the callback while addEventListener is a function that accepts a callback. See what a callback is now?
Callbacks. Callbacks in JavaScript are functions that are passed as arguments to other functions. This is a very important feature of asynchronous programming, and it enables the function that receives the callback to call our code when it finishes a long task, while allowing us to continue the execution of the code. In JavaScript, you can also pass a function as an argument to a function. This function that is passed as an argument inside of another function is called a callback function. For example, 17/6/2021 · When you want one function to execute only after another function has completed its execution, we use callback functions in JavaScript. It needs to pass as a parameter to other functions to make a function callback. The function which accepts the callback as a parameter is known as "High order function".
jQuery Callback Functions JavaScript statements are executed line by line. However, with effects, the next line of code can be run even though the effect is not finished. This can create errors. Jun 10, 2020 - If you’re familiar with programming, you already know what functions do and how to use them. But what is a callback function? Callback functions are an important part of JavaScript and once you understand how callbacks work, you’ll become much better in JavaScript. So in this post, I In JavaScript, a callback is a function passed into another function as an argument to be executed later. Suppose that you the following numbers array: let numbers = [ 1, 2, 4, 7, 3, 5, 6 ]; Code language: JavaScript (javascript) To find all the odd numbers in the array, you can use the filter () method of the Array object.
Callbacks are one of the critical elements to understand JavaScript and Node.js. Nearly, all the asynchronous functions use a callback (or promises). In this post, we are going to cover callbacks in-depth and best practices. A callback function is essentially a pattern (an established solution to a common problem), and therefore, the use of a callback function is also known as a callback pattern. Consider this common use of a callback function in jQuery: 1. 2. 3. $ ("#btn").click (function() {. alert ("Button is clicked"); Jul 20, 2021 - A common mistake for new JavaScript programmers is to extract a method from an object, then to later call that function and expect it to use the original object as its this (e.g., by using the method in callback-based code).
14/4/2020 · What are Callbacks First, we will see a regular javascript function, and from there we will see how callbacks are used. Regular Javascript function So first let us look at a normal Function in javascript. function multiply(a, b) { var result = a * b; console.log("multiply Function Result:",result); } multiply(2, 4); Here we have a simple function which multiplies 2 numbers. All functions in JavaScript are objects, hence like any other object, a JavaScript function can be passed another function as an argument. There are many inbuilt functions which use callbacks. A custom callback function can be created by using the callback keyword as the last parameter. Feb 02, 2016 - The method of passing in functions as parameters to other functions to use them inside is used in JavaScript libraries almost everywhere · A JavaScript Callback Function is a function that is passed as a parameter to another JavaScript function, and the callback function is run inside of the ...
Create a Callback Alright, enough talk, lets create a callback! First, open up your browser developer console (you can do this by pressing Ctrl + Shift + J on Windows/Linux, or Cmd + Option + J on... Callback function basic syntax. We have to declare the callback function as a variable and call it in several places like above. In that case, we can use it by callback it at the usual time. Apr 28, 2021 - Incidentally, you don’t have to use the word “callback” as the name of your argument, Javascript just needs to know that it’s the correct argument name. Based on the above example, the below function will behave in exactly the same manner.
Using Callbacks with Events Callbacks are commonly used with JavaScript events. Events listen out for an action, like a user clicking a button, and run a block of code when that action is taken. Let's create a callback which runs when a user hovers over an image. Callback Functions. A callback function is simply a function that is passed into another function as an argument, which is then triggered when the other function is executed. The following is an example of using a simple callback function. Let's start by creating an array of numbers that we will use in our example ‒. Callback Functions A callback function is a function that is passed as an argument to another function, to be "called back" at a later time. A function that accepts other functions as arguments is called a higher-order function, which contains the logic for when the callback function gets executed.
The functions/methods accepting callbacks may also accept a value to which this of the callback should refer. It is the same as binding yourself, but the method/function is doing it instead of you: arr.map (callback [, thisArg]) So, the first argument is the callback, and the value this should refer to the second one. In the example above, myDisplayer is the name of a function. It is passed to myCalculator() as an argument. When you pass a function as an argument, remember not to use parenthesis. ... The examples above are not very exciting. They are simplified to teach you the callback syntax. Callbacks added with then() will never be invoked before the completion of the current run of the JavaScript event loop. These callbacks will be invoked even if they were added after the success or failure of the asynchronous operation that the promise represents. Multiple callbacks may be added by calling then() several times. They will be ...
Dec 18, 2020 - A callback function is a function passed into another function as an argument, which is then invoked inside the outer function to complete some kind of routine or action. To demonstrate the use of callbacks, promises and other abstract concepts, we'll be using some browser methods: specifically, loading scripts and performing simple document manipulations. If you're not familiar with these methods, and their usage in the examples is confusing, you may want to read a few chapters from the next part of the ... Nov 28, 2016 - Another common manifestation of ... is used as callback/event handler. Functions are first-class citizens in JavaScript and the term "method" is just a colloquial term for a function that is a value of an object property. But that function doesn't have a specific link to its "containing" ...
JavaScript. JavaScript is synchronous by default and is single threaded. This means that code cannot create new threads and run in parallel. Lines of code are executed in series, one after another, for example: JS. const a = 1. const b = 2. const c = a * b. console.log(c) When to use callback functions in JavaScript? The callback function is used in several tasks such as when working with the file system (downloading or uploading), Sending the network request to get some resources such as test or binary file from the server, Jan 23, 2014 - Function binding is probably your least concern when beginning with JavaScript, but when you realize that you need a solution to the problem of how to keep the context of “this” within another function, then you might not realize that what you actually need is Function.prototype.bind().
The method of passing in functions as parameters to other functions to use them inside is used in JavaScript libraries almost everywhere · A JavaScript Callback Function is a function that is passed as a parameter to another JavaScript function, and the callback function is run inside of the ... 4. I am very new to JavaScript and need to use callback function in my java script function. I don't know how to use a callback function. Below is my code: function SelectedFeature () { // Here is my code call_Method1 (); call_Method2 (); } The problem in the above function is that, call_method2 () starts executing before call_Method1 () ends ... Synchronous callback function runs like normal JavaScript one by one in order while the Asynchronous callback function runs when it's called after the job is done. ... To demonstrate the use of ...
Javascript What The Heck Is A Callback By Brandon Morelli
Async Await In Node Js How To Master It Risingstack
How Javascript Works Event Loop And The Rise Of Async
Javascript Callbacks Vs Promises Vs Async Await Vegibit
How To Avoid Infinite Nesting Callbacks
Mastering This In Javascript Callbacks And Bind Apply
Javascript Callback Functions An In Depth Guide Dzone Web Dev
Javascript Callback Functions What Are Callbacks In Js And
Javascript What Are Callbacks And How To Use Them
Javascript Callback Functions How To With Examples
Callback Functions In Javascript What Is A Callback Function
Tools Qa What Are Callback Functions In Javascript And How
Asynchronous Javascript Callbacks And Promises Explained
What Are Callback Functions Javascript Tutorial
Javascript Callback Functions What Are Callbacks In Js And
Deeply Understanding Javascript Async And Await With Examples
Callback Hell Promises And Async Await
Callbacks In Javascript Zell Liew
Mastering This In Javascript Callbacks And Bind Apply
Asynchronous Javascript Async Await Tutorial Toptal
Understanding Callbacks In Javascript Javascript
How Does Callback Work In Javascript Scotch Io
The Use Of Js Callback Function
Introduction To Javascript Callbacks By Mahendra Choudhary
The Basic Use Of Web Notes Layerui And The Writing Of
0 Response to "27 How To Use Callback In Javascript"
Post a Comment